    A wide variety of musical forms can be found here, from eggae to Appalachian hill music, from city ock to country roll. And while this sounds like a hodgepodge, John Sebastian manages to pull it off with his usual aplomb. Highlights include "Dixie Chicken" (made famous by Little Feat), "Sitting in Limbo" (from the Jimmy Cliff songbook), and Sebastian's version of "Stories We Could Tell" (already made famous by the Everly Brothers).

Originally released in 1974, TARZANA KID was only Sebastian's third post-Spoonful studio album. And while it failed to chart, it did reunite him with Spoonful producer Erik Jacobsen. The album kicks off with a heartfelt cover of Jimmy Cliff's "Sitting in Limbo."
